Output de516ead8aa0e0fc82082eaad322da99eb3688faf65cf8cb5ca834e7911f5673:157

value
152638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4bfe8f468ad7ea8a9343810f4a16f9aa6d58da OP_EQUAL
address
3QscbT5BAJuVZkx6CJARJZzV27CMeuamyc
transaction
de516ead8aa0e0fc82082eaad322da99eb3688faf65cf8cb5ca834e7911f5673